The Downtowner Woodfire Grill, St. Paul - 11/3/2024 Formerly known as the Downtowner Café, this beloved St. Paul eatery has transformed from a local diner serving breakfast and lunch into the warm and welcoming Downtowner Woodfire Grill. We have cherished this spot since its café days, when it was a favorite among local police and cab drivers. Walking into the new space, we were amazed by its inviting atmosphere, and we've been loyal patrons all along. Two standout dishes keep us coming back: Moe's Cajun Breakfast and the Belgian Waffle. Moe's Cajun Breakfast features a hearty mix of hashbrowns, green peppers, onions, mushrooms, Cajun sausage, over-easy eggs, cheese, Hollandaise sauce, and toast ($17 or $15 for a half order). It's a delicious and filling meal, especially with a drizzle of the zesty green sauce. The Belgian Waffle ($14) is equally tempting, and I love to add a combination of fruits like strawberries, blueberries or bananas (just $1.50 extra). Choosing between the Cajun breakfast and the waffle is always a dilemma; both are exceptional.
